Safety Coordinator A Safety Technician supports an organization's health and safety program by conducting inspections, identifying hazards, assisting with incident prevention, and helping ensure compliance with applicable safety regulations and internal policies. The role is typically hands-on, field-based, and focused on monitoring day-to-day safety practices. Key Responsibilities
Perform routine safety inspections of work areas, equipment, tools, and job sites. Identify unsafe conditions and behaviors; document findings and recommend corrective actions. Verify that safety guards, emergency exits, signage, and warning systems are in place and functional. Support job safety analyses (JSAs) and risk assessments.
Compliance Support
Assist with maintaining compliance with relevant regulations (e.g., OSHA and local/state requirements). Help track safety permits, certifications, and required postings. Maintain safety documentation such as inspection logs, training records, SDS (Safety Data Sheets), and audit results.
Incident Reporting & Investigation
Respond to incidents and near-misses, ensuring proper reporting procedures are followed. Assist with investigations, including evidence gathering, witness statements, and root cause analysis support. Track corrective and preventive actions to closure.
Training & Safety Communication
Support safety orientations for new hires and contractors. Assist in delivering toolbox talks and refresher training. Promote safe work practices through coaching and communication in the field. Help develop or update safety signage, bulletins, and standard operating procedures (SOPs).
PPE & Safety Equipment Management
Monitor and enforce appropriate use of personal protective equipment (PPE). Assist with PPE selection, issuance, and inventory tracking. Inspect and help maintain emergency equipment (e.g., eyewash stations, fire extinguishers, first-aid kits, spill kits).
Program Support & Continuous Improvement
Participate in safety audits and safety committee meetings. Help compile safety metrics (e.g., incident rates, inspection trends). Support continuous improvement initiatives to reduce risk and improve safety culture.
